Output 1f840e2d949b5dca4efef5fd25571e679efea5e0fa35096e17ea83eec111f2f7:67

value
49989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 879a8504495aba2a2ccc4913b45f25525d397f14 OP_EQUAL
address
3E42Feh4BV3sz5VJBnb6AnFVrcyej1zFX3
transaction
1f840e2d949b5dca4efef5fd25571e679efea5e0fa35096e17ea83eec111f2f7
confirmations
273503
spent
true